The Shifting Sands: What's Trending in Influencer Marketing Right Now?
Alright, let's get straight to it: influencer marketing trends are constantly on the move, and staying updated is like trying to catch lightning in a bottle, right? But seriously, guys, the biggest shift we're seeing is the move away from just follower count and towards genuine engagement and authentic connection. Brands are wising up, and they want to see that influencers are actually talking to their audience, not just broadcasting to them. This means micro and nano-influencers are having a major moment. Why? Because they often have super niche audiences who trust their recommendations implicitly. Think about it: if you're looking for eco-friendly travel tips, you're probably going to trust someone with 5,000 followers who lives and breathes sustainable tourism way more than a mega-celebrity who posts about it once a year. We're also seeing a huge surge in video content, especially short-form video. TikTok, Instagram Reels, YouTube Shorts β these platforms are dominating. Influencers who can create engaging, creative, and snackable video content are gold. It's not just about looking pretty on camera anymore; it's about storytelling, personality, and delivering value in a concise format. Another massive trend is the rise of AI in influencer marketing. Now, before you freak out, it's not about replacing humans (phew!). AI is being used for everything from identifying the perfect influencers for a brand to analyzing campaign performance and even generating content ideas. It's about making the process smarter, more efficient, and data-driven. So, if you haven't started exploring how AI can enhance your influencer strategies, now's the time, seriously. And let's not forget about long-term partnerships. Brands are realizing that one-off campaigns are often less effective than building sustained relationships with influencers. This allows for deeper storytelling, more authentic brand integration, and a stronger connection with the audience over time. Think co-created content, brand ambassadorships that feel genuine, and influencers who truly embody the brand's values. Itβs all about building trust and loyalty, both for the influencer and the brand they represent. The landscape is undeniably complex, but by focusing on these key trends β authenticity, video, AI, and long-term relationships β you'll be well on your way to making informed decisions in this fast-paced industry. Navigating the Influencer Marketplace: Today's Key Trades and Opportunities
So, you've got the trends, but what about the actual trades happening in the influencer world today? It's not just about buying followers or sponsoring a single post anymore, guys. We're talking about strategic investments and partnerships that are driving real business results. One of the biggest opportunities right now is in creator-led commerce. This is where influencers aren't just promoting products; they're actually selling them directly through shoppable content, their own product lines, or affiliate marketing that's deeply integrated into their content. Think of those influencers who have their own curated shops on Instagram or drop their own limited-edition merch β that's creator-led commerce in action, and it's booming. Brands are actively seeking out influencers who have a proven track record of driving sales, not just vanity metrics. Another significant area of opportunity lies in data-driven influencer selection. Gone are the days of picking influencers based on a gut feeling. Today, sophisticated platforms and agencies are using AI and analytics to identify influencers whose audience demographics, engagement patterns, and content style perfectly align with a brand's target market. This means fewer wasted marketing dollars and a higher likelihood of success. If you're a brand, investing in these data-backed selection tools is a smart move. If you're an influencer, understanding your analytics and being able to present them clearly is key to landing better deals. We're also seeing a rise in performance-based marketing within influencer collaborations. Instead of paying a flat fee, some brands are offering bonuses or commissions based on sales generated, leads acquired, or other key performance indicators. This model aligns incentives and ensures that both the brand and the influencer are motivated to achieve the best possible outcome. It's a win-win situation when done right. Furthermore, the globalization of influencer marketing presents a massive opportunity. With platforms allowing for cross-border reach, brands can now tap into diverse markets by collaborating with influencers from different countries and cultural backgrounds. This requires careful consideration of cultural nuances and language, but the potential for expanding reach and tapping into new customer bases is enormous. For influencers, this means a wider pool of potential brand partners. Finally, keep an eye on the evolving creator economy. This isn't just about influencers; it's about the entire ecosystem of tools, platforms, and services that support creators. Investing in or utilizing these resources can provide a competitive advantage, whether it's for content creation, audience management, or monetization.
